Ride-hailing and food delivery firm Uber have announced a new same-day delivery service to help both customers and drivers during the current lockdown.


Costing the same as a regular UberX journey, the new product called Uber Connect will initially be available in Manchester, Birmingham and Leeds as a pilot programme.

Uber Connect allows users to deliver parcels and packages by tapping into the existing Uber network. Users can order in-app, with the same notifications and ability to track the parcel in-app in real-time.


Jamie Heywood, Regional General Manager for Northern and Eastern Europe at Uber, said: “Daily life remains very different this year and we want to help people keep in touch while staying safe at home as lockdown continues. Uber Connect means you can send that last minute gift that you accidentally forgot, share a book you loved with one of your friends, or documents for a work colleague.”


Uber hopes the additional service will not only help people get the items they need, but also provide driver-partners on the Uber platform a new earnings opportunity.
